Makai Lemon, Philadelphia Eagles, Round 1, Pick 20

The Eagles selected wide receiver Makai Lemon with the 20th overall pick in the 2026 NFL Draft. Lemon, a USC product, now joins an Eagles offense that is expected to reset with A.J. Brown departing.

Projected Role in the Eagles Offense

  • Lemon will be an immediate starter in an Eagles offense in transition.
  • Expected snap share: 80%
  • Timeline to start: Week 1 Starter
  • Primary competition: Operating under the assumption that Brown is no longer an Eagle, Lemon's primary competition will be veterans Marquise Brown, Dontayvion Wicks, and Elijah Moore. Tight end Dallas Goedert will be the primary competition as the secondary target behind DeVonta Smith

Key Takeaways

Fantasy Football Impact of Makai Lemon on the Philadelphia Eagles

The A.J. Brown trade is all but official. The Eagles need to wait until after June 1st to trade Brown, and rumors hit draft week that a deal with New England is expected. 

Lemon provides both an immediate potential starter and a long-term passing game focal point as Smith enters his age-28 season. 

The Eagles have not been a high-volume passing attack, potentially limiting Lemon's path to fantasy utility as Smith and Brown became a feared fantasy pairing due to their big-play ability. Goedert enjoyed a breakout 2025 season, and most of his impact came in the screen and short passing game, a projected strength for Lemon. 

Many view Lemon primarily as a slot receiver; in Philadelphia's attack, he will need to show the ability to consistently win outside.
